Fort Perch Rock is a historical fortress located on the Wirral Peninsula in Merseyside, England. This iconic landmark has been a significant part of the region's history and has now become a popular tourist attraction, offering stunning views and historical significance. The fortress, which was built in the 19th century, has been well-preserved and is open to the public for exploration and learning about its rich history. It also hosts various events, including concerts and entertainment, making it a versatile and dynamic destination for visitors of all ages. From its striking architecture to its scenic coastal location, Fort Perch Rock offers a unique and memorable experience for all who visit.
